Mastercard has launched Fintech Express in the Middle East and Africa (MEA), a program designed to facilitate emerging fintechs’ launch and expansion. Leveraging the power of partnerships and Mastercard’s expertise, technology, and global network, startups will now be able to focus on innovation that drives the digital economy. Mastercard Fintech Express is designed for all types of fintechs: established fintechs wanting a direct license from Mastercard, as well as fintechs with the ambition to innovate through collaborating with ready-to-go Mastercard Engage partners.
